On Thu, Sep 15, 2005 at 07:22:25AM -0500, Stephen R Marenka wrote: >Package: pbzip2 >Version: 0.9.4-1 >Severity: serious >Justification: fails to build on release candidate arch. >Tags: sid > > >pbzip2 fails to build from source on m68k. This is likely due >to bug #317475 on gcc-4.0. As a workaround, you might try compiling with >less optimization or gcc-3.3/gcc-3.4.
It would be nice if the optimization downgrade is done _only_ for m68k as I did it for pbzip2 with the attached patch. >A full buildd log is available at ><http://buildd.debian.org/build.php?pkg=pbzip2&ver=0.9.4-1&arch=m68k> > >Other buildd logs may be available at ><http://buildd.debian.org/build.php?arch=&pkg=pbzip2> > >-- >Stephen R. diff -u pbzip2-0.9.4/debian/rules pbzip2-0.9.4/debian/rules
--- pbzip2-0.9.4/debian/rules
+++ pbzip2-0.9.4/debian/rules
@@ -10,7 +10,8 @@
# Uncomment this to turn on verbose mode.
export DH_VERBOSE=1
-CFLAGS = -Wall -g
+DEB_HOST_ARCH := $(shell dpkg-architecture -qDEB_HOST_ARCH)
+CFLAGS = -Wall
ifneq (,$(findstring noopt,$(DEB_BUILD_OPTIONS)))
CFLAGS += -O0
@@ -18,6 +19,10 @@
CFLAGS += -O2
endif
+ifneq (,$(findstring m68k,$(DEB_HOST_ARCH)))
+ CFLAGS = -Wall -O0
+endif
+
configure: configure-stamp
configure-stamp:
dh_testdir
@@ -31,7 +36,7 @@
dh_testdir
# Add here commands to compile the package.
- $(MAKE)
+ $(MAKE) CFLAGS="$(CFLAGS)"
touch build-stamp
